Not many know that Joy, our therapy dog, makes house calls. People are used to seeing her at our Compassionate Care Center, but we care for about 90 patients and their families each day in their homes, in six counties.
Mr. Isaacs is one of them. He was at our Compassionate Care Center for respite care once and fell in love with Joy. His hospice home care team offered to bring her to visit sometime. It happened today, and you can see how happy he is. Joy earns her name every day!

Hospice Care Plus empowers those we serve to enjoy the highest quality of life, respecting their values, beliefs, needs, and goals through specialized care, education, resources, and grief support.
Our Service Area:
Our Home Hospice and Home Palliative Care programs serve you, wherever you call home, in the Kentucky counties of Estill, Jackson, Lee, Madison, Owsley, and Rockcastle.
Our inpatient care facility, the Compassionate Care Center, and administrative offices are located in Richmond, Kentucky.
